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88717 617 751 16
137753314 745
137753314 745
32 530 654861331 2249109
All about undefined
Interested in learning more?
137753314 745
32 530 654861331 2249109
See more
0596 230819 05
38052 29806774 86915887902
See more
6376200 708126 819874784
2547434 60062710016 0479162
See more